Ado.Stream en asp
Publicado por jaime (1 intervención) el 28/07/2009 07:26:06
Hola
Tengo en una base de datos sql server un campo varbinary(max) en el que se almacena un archivo, puede ser de cualquier extension. Esto lo hago en una aplicacion vb6 usando aso.stream. Tambien, uso ado.stream para leer el archivo de la base de datos.
Mi pregunta es, como puedo leer el archivo de la base de datos usando ado.stream en asp clasico????
A continuacion pongo el codigo que uso en vb6 para leer un archivo
xSql = "select * from ArchivosAdjuntos where codigo=" & List1.Text
oRegistros.Open xSql
rutaarchivo = "D:FolderArchivos" & oRegistros.Fields("narchivo").Value
Set mstream = New ADODB.Stream
mstream.Type = adTypeBinary
mstream.Open
mstream.Write oRegistros.Fields("adjunto").Value
mstream.SaveToFile rutaarchivo, adSaveCreateOverWrite
de antemano muchas gracias por la ayuda que me puedan dar
Tengo en una base de datos sql server un campo varbinary(max) en el que se almacena un archivo, puede ser de cualquier extension. Esto lo hago en una aplicacion vb6 usando aso.stream. Tambien, uso ado.stream para leer el archivo de la base de datos.
Mi pregunta es, como puedo leer el archivo de la base de datos usando ado.stream en asp clasico????
A continuacion pongo el codigo que uso en vb6 para leer un archivo
xSql = "select * from ArchivosAdjuntos where codigo=" & List1.Text
oRegistros.Open xSql
rutaarchivo = "D:FolderArchivos" & oRegistros.Fields("narchivo").Value
Set mstream = New ADODB.Stream
mstream.Type = adTypeBinary
mstream.Open
mstream.Write oRegistros.Fields("adjunto").Value
mstream.SaveToFile rutaarchivo, adSaveCreateOverWrite
de antemano muchas gracias por la ayuda que me puedan dar
Valora esta pregunta


0